EX3110 extender, wrong password.
When I attempt to log in to my EX3110 extender to get internet from the rouder, using the rouder password, I get this messages, "wrong password", This EX3110 is useless to me, because I don´t have any internet connection from this EX3110 extender. Therefore I can´t open, xxxxxxxxxx.net, (which is not permitted to mention in this community), whith this EX3110 extender to see the password which is incluted whith it, if there is, or/and to change the password. The NETGEAR downloads don´t answer anything, If you want answers to, "HOW TO DO" questions, If I´m not conected through this EX3110 extender. How stupid is that? Here is my question: Why do I get this message from this EX3110 if there is no password, (In the Quick Start brochure, they say that I shall use the router password), what can I do to get internet connection with EX3110, using the router password?

Hi nonnibestur, welcome to the community! If you haven't setup the extender yet then there will be no password. One indicator that the extender is not yet setup is that it will broadcast the "NETGEAR_EXT" SSID/WiFi name. It is best if you do a factory reset on the extender and start from scratch in setting it up. The installation guide linked below may help out.
